Session 1: Update from the USPTO - Hear about the most current priorities, programs, and initiatives underway at the Agency.
 
Session 2: The Enhanced Patent Quality Initiative: Where Are We Now? -
 
Session 3: Update from the Office of the Solicitor - An update on the recent cases handled by the Solicitor’s Office.
